Europe’s top clubs can bank on getting more Champions League prize money for the next three years. UEFA marketing officials told European Club Association members on Tuesday to expect a 30 percent raise in Champions League revenues for the 2015-18 commercial sales cycle. ”The European football family is very strong, united and fortunately wealthy as well,” said Karl-Heinz Rummenigge, chairman of the ECA and Bayern Munich. The 32 clubs in the group stage currently share more than 900 million euros ($ 1.16 billion) in UEFA prize money.
